6. Conclusion

This article presents the key elements for understanding the mechanisms at work in slope instability, the main methods for assessing instability and the techniques for reinforcement and monitoring. However, the extreme variety of slopes means that the engineer's judgment is essential, as are the means used to refine the geological, hydrogeological and geomechanical models (synthesized in the geotechnical model).

The transition to the design approaches introduced by Eurocode 7 and its national application standards means that we need to reconsider the ranges of variation accepted by practitioners when considering stable structures.
